Where does “אויבן” come from?
אויבן (Yiddish) comes from Middle High German oben, from Old High German obana, from Proto-Germanic *obanā, from Proto-Germanic ubanē, from Proto-Germanic upp, from Proto-Germanic ub, from Proto-Indo-European upó, from Proto-Indo-European h₃ewp-.
אויבן (Yiddish): above
